Violating his name - stay away
This company (L.Collari Innotech) is violationg the use of Lamberto Collari's name. They are using his name for selling products that has nothing to do with Lamberto. Don't be fooled by this! They have nothing to do with the multiple world champion... and has not been developed by him. This is the link for that company without honour:
http://www.lcollari-innotech.com/ Since 2002 the only company that has the rights to produce engines in Lambertos name is Lavorazioni Meccaniche, that produces the Sirio engines. http://www.lambertocollari.com/ http://www.star-motor.com |

They are not modified at all, they are regular Picco engines.
The OFNA/Picco 7 port is the same engine as the Collari/Picco 5 port, just different terminology. Collari doesn't count the bypass port, Ofna does..... I don't know if the new Sirio based Collari's are made to his specs. |
